A mustard-spiked cheese sauce cloaks ham and broccoli, and is stirred into pasta. It's a recipe for a quick-cooking family favorite!
Heat the soup, milk, mustard and broccoli in a 10-inch skillet over medium-high heat to a boil. Reduce the heat to low. Cook for 5 minutes or until the broccoli is tender.Stir the ham and pasta in the skillet and cook until the mixture is hot and bubbling.
1 can (10 1/2 ounces) Campbell’s® Condensed Broccoli Cheese Soup2 cups broccoli florets or 1 package (10 ounces) frozen broccoli cuts, thawed1 cup milk1 tablespoon spicy brown mustard1.5 cups cooked ham cut into strips2.25 cups medium shell shaped pasta, cooked and drained
